The intersection: The cars across from each other get a "left turn" signal first, at which point pedestrians are supposed to wait. Once each opposite side gets its regular green light and the left turn signal turns into a "left turn on yield", *then* pedestrians are allowed to cross. Let's say... sides 1 and 2 are opposite each other. There's two lanes per side (dedicated left turn, and then forward/right turn lane).

Side 1/2's "left turn on green" light comes on. Car 1 in the Side 1's *right-turn* lane (whose light is still red) turns right, Car 2 in Side 2's left turn lane (who had the right of way because green light) is already in the intersection and proceeds to accelerate following Car 1.

BUT WAIT
A jogger also decided to just run out in the street after Car 1 passed. Car 2 slams on the brakes so as not to hit the jogger.

There is no accident, but hypothetically...

a) If Car 2 hit the jogger, would the car be at fault (the car had the right of way) or would the jogger be at fault (the jogger should have waited for their pedestrian signal)
b) If the car behind Car 2 hit Car 2... well, that car would probably be at fault, but would the jogger have any responsibility in causing the accident?
